Persona Super Live 2022 Concert Set for October

Atlus has announced that 2022's Persona Super Live concert will be happening in October, closing the series' year-long 25th anniversary celebrations.

Atlus announced in July of 2021 that it’d be celebrating the 25th anniversary of Persona with seven new announcements over the course of about a year, but while many were expecting the developer to announce at least some new games, so far, most have been pretty disappointed with the reveals, which have focused largely on merchandise. That might change in the later months of this year though.

Atlus recently announced that 2022’s Persona Super Live concert has been set for October 8 and October 9. As always, the concert will feature live performances of fan-favourite songs from across the series, but these concerts have often also been the stage where Atlus has chosen to announce new games in the series over the years.

Both Persona 5 and Persona 5 Royal, for instance, were first announced at Persona Super Live concerts, as were spinoffs such as Persona Q: Shadow: Shadow of the Labyrinth, Persona Q2: New Cinema Labyrinth, Persona 5 Strikers, and Persona 4: Dancing All Night.

There’s no shortage of rumours and leaks surrounding the Persona franchise that could materialize at this event (or so fans will be hoping, at least). We know for a fact that Persona 6 is currently in the works, while leaks have also mentioned Persona 5 spinoff starring Goro Akechi, a multiplatform Persona 3 Portable remaster, and Nintendo Switch and PS4 versions of Persona 4 Golden.
